A reservoir at the foot of Śnieżnik

The reservoir in Stara Morawa lies in the Śnieżnik Massif, about 1.3 km from Stronie Śląskie in Lower Silesian Voivodeship. It was created in 2007 with European funding and ranks among the highest-lying reservoirs in Poland. It was designed for water retention, but from the outset it was also meant as a recreational base for residents and visitors.

What is on site

The shores are extensively developed. A beach with a supervised bathing area occupies the south-western side, and there are a pier and jetties, a viewing tower, a camping and tent field, sports pitches, a playground with a climbing wall, outdoor chess tables and a table-tennis table. Catering and sanitary facilities operate here, so a stay can easily be extended over several days.

Trips in the area

The reservoir works well as a base. The trails of the Śnieżnik Massif, including the slopes of Krzyżnik, start nearby, as does the route to the Bear Cave in Kletno. In winter the nearby ski resorts of Czarna Góra and Kamienica operate, while Stronie Śląskie provides basic supplies.
